Summary:


Team Leader will provide leadership and direction to all associates assigned to the Mid Shift in the Fairhaven Distribution Center. Ensure daily production targets are communicated and met while meeting or exceeding all standards for safety, efficiency, team-work, and customer service. Ensure the security of the facility during the shift. Work in cooperation with all members of the Distribution operations leadership team to meet daily production targets while providing a safe working environment.


Responsibilities:



  • Provide leadership by coaching and developing all second shift associates. Ensure all training is prepared and executed in accordance with the Distribution Training Schedule and identify individual associate needs. Monitor associate performance and identify opportunities for retraining and/or performance management. Ensure all training results are documented as part of the Distribution Training Program.

  • Communicate expectations and results. Constantly monitor individual and group production levels and provide regular, positive, and constructive, performance feedback. Ensure work areas are staffed to meet production and efficiency goals. Foster an idea-generation, problem-solving culture, and drive for continuous improvement. Execute approved continuous improvement initiatives.

  • Provide a safe, healthy, clean environment for all associates. Ensure all facility safety procedures are always followed by associates. Investigate safety incidents and near misses. Determine and document root cause, corrective actions, and any follow up activities with company resources in resolving safety issues. Initiate maintenance requests as necessary; monitor work order status and follow up with facilities resources as necessary. Ensure daily housekeeping activities are completed as scheduled.

  • Monitor associate performance quality and provide regular feedback. Determine root causes for quality issues and develop options for eliminating these issues. Resolve all quality and accuracy issues in a timely manner.

  • Ensure all work area equipment and tools are in proper working order. Ensure all RF-devices, computer workstations, and communication devices are accounted for and are working properly. Coordinate all internal and external service providers as needed and ensure all vendors receive required safety training. Ensure all supplies meet established quality and performance standards. Monitor inventory levels and usage of supplies, coordinate reordering of supplies as necessary.

  • Ensure administrative tasks (payroll, vacation planning, time and attendance, benefits selection, etc) for assigned associates are completed in a timely manner. Resolve system related issues.

  • Ensure a good transition between shifts. Ensure daily plans and directions are transferred to all associates. Communicate end-of-shift status of work and any resolved/unresolved issues. Escalate off hours issues as necessary if immediate notification of senior management is required. Provide inventory control and production management support for 2nd shift operations.

  • Perform other duties as assigned, including back up for other team lead roles throughout the Distribution team.


Requirements:



  • BS degree preferred, preferably in operations management or supply chain management.

  • Additional training in continuous improvement, safety, team building, and change management desirable.

  • Two years of supervisory experience required.

  • Three years of experience in distribution/warehouse operations required.

  • Proven ability to lead and motivate others. Proven ability to implement change within a group of associates.

  • Proven ability to drive performance improvement of individuals and groups.

  • Experience using computer-based operations and performance management system preferred.

  • Ability to review operations in a warehouse setting. Climbing of stairs, long periods of standing, sitting. Ability to lift up to 40 pounds.

  • Frequent use of computer to review work status and perform administrative tasks.
